IN THE HIGH COURT OF JUDICATURE AT MADRAS

DATED : 11.09.2015 CORAM :

THE HONOURABLE MR.JUSTICE M.M.SUNDRESH W.P.No.19044 of 2015 Tmt.S.Uma Maheswari ... Petitioner Vs.

The Tahsildar, Triplicane Taluk, Triplicane, Chennai - 5.

... Respondent PRAYER: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India for the issuance of a Writ of Mandamus to direct the respondent to consider and pass orders on merits by disposing the written representation made by the petitioner on 7.11.2014 within a stipulated time.

For Petitioner : Mr.C.Prakasam For Respondent : Mr.S.Diwakar, Additional Government Pleader

ORDER

Learned Additional Government Pleader appearing for the respondent submitted that representation dated 7.11.2014 made by the petitioner has been considered and rejected by the respondent.

2. In view of the submission made by the learned Additional Government Pleader appearing for the respondent, the writ petition is dismissed. However, liberty is given to the petitioner to challenge the order of rejection passed by the respondent. No costs.
